20110088196 | SURFACE TREATING APPLIANCE - An upright surface treating appliance includes a main body having a user operable handle, a surface treating head connected to a yoke moveable relative to the main body, a stand moveable relative to both the main body and the yoke between a supporting position for supporting the main body in an upright position, and a retracted position, and a stand retaining mechanism for releasably retaining the stand in the supporting position and from which the stand is releasable upon application of a force to one of the main body and the stand. The yoke is moveable relative to the main body in response to an impact on the surface treating head to apply said force to the stand. This allows the force of the impact on the surface treating head to be transferred through the stand to the stand retaining mechanism, which, depending on the magnitude of the impact, can release both the stand and the yoke for movement relative to the main body. This avoids the need to provide separate releasing mechanisms for both the yoke and the stand. | 04-21-2011 |

20110088206 | SURFACE TREATING APPLIANCE - An upright surface treating appliance includes a main body and a cleaner head connected to a yoke. The main body is rotatable relative to the yoke about a first axis for movement between an upright position and a reclined position. A stand is moveable relative to both the main body and the yoke, preferably also about this first axis between a supporting position for supporting the main body in its upright position, and a retracted position. The stand is biased towards its retracted position by a spring. An actuator is rotatable about a second axis spaced from the first axis to move the stand away from its supporting position against the biasing force of the torsion spring. A drive member drives rotation of the actuator about the second axis as the main body is moved from a reclined position to an upright position. The actuator has a set of teeth which meshes with a profiled surface to drive the movement of the stand away from its supporting position | 04-21-2011 |

20130081222 | UPRIGHT VACUUM CLEANER - An upright vacuum cleaner comprising a wand fluidly connected to a separating apparatus on the cleaner via a hose and which is used, as required, to clean above the level of the floor. The wand is at least partly retractable inside the hose for storage, and a hose catch is provided at the end of the hose, this hose catch being biased towards a locking position in which the hose catch locks the wand in an extended position. According to the invention, the hose is a stretch hose arranged, in its coil-bound state, to act as a reaction member against which a user may readily force the biased hose catch out of said locking position using the extended wand. | 04-04-2013 |

20130285740 | DYNAMIC CHARACTERISATION OF AMPLIFIER AM-PM DISTORTION - There is disclosed a method of determining an AM-PM distortion measurement for an amplifier, the method comprising: generating a test waveform to be provided to the input of the amplifier; periodically puncturing the test waveform with a fixed-level reference signal to generate a modified test waveform which alternates between test periods in which a portion of the test waveform is present and reference periods in which the fixed-level reference signal is present; measuring the amplifier AM-PM distortion in a test period; measuring the phase difference between the input and the output of the amplifier in reference periods either side of the test period; estimating a phase error in the test period in dependence on phase differences measured in the reference periods; and estimating the true amplifier AM-PM distortion by removing the estimated phase error from the measured amplifier AM-PM distortion. | 10-31-2013 |

20150290634 | Catalyst and Process for Synthesising the Same - The invention relates to a method for synthesising tethered ruthenium catalysts and novel tethered ruthenium catalysts obtainable by this methods. The method involves carrying out an “arene swapping” reaction avoiding the requirement to use complicated techniques making use of unreliable Birch reductions and unstable cyclodienyl intermediates. | 10-15-2015 |
